Caring for Aging Loved Ones: Addressing Changes in Personal Hygiene

As our loved ones age, their health can decline, leading to new challenges—especially around personal hygiene. Sometimes, you might notice unpleasant odors or hygiene changes, which can be distressing, especially when it involves someone dear like your grandmother. Understanding why these changes happen helps you respond with compassion and find effective solutions.

Why Hygiene Matters for Health and Well-Being

Good hygiene supports both physical and mental health. Poor hygiene can cause skin infections, dental problems, and increase illness risks. It can also lower self-esteem, isolate individuals, and lead to depression. These effects are often stronger in elderly people due to weaker immune systems and limited mobility.

How to Talk About Hygiene with Compassion

Discussing hygiene can be sensitive. Approach the topic gently, avoiding judgment or criticism. Use “I” statements like, “I noticed you might need some help with…” to express concern without causing defensiveness. This opens the door for honest and caring conversations.

Identifying Why Hygiene Declines

Several factors may cause hygiene neglect in the elderly:

  • Physical challenges such as arthritis or balance problems can make bathing hard.

  • Cognitive decline or dementia may reduce awareness of hygiene needs.

  • Depression or emotional struggles can also play a role.

Pinpointing the root causes helps you address the problem properly.

Creating a Supportive Home Environment

Make the home safer and more accessible for hygiene tasks. Install grab bars, use non-slip mats, and keep bathing supplies easy to reach. A positive, respectful environment encourages your grandmother to maintain her routines comfortably.

Practical Steps to Help Improve Hygiene

  1. Start with Sensitivity
    Choose a private moment and use gentle, supportive language.

  2. Visit Regularly
    Frequent visits provide emotional support and help you monitor her condition.

  3. Seek Medical Advice
    A healthcare professional can spot health issues causing hygiene problems.

  4. Use Easy Bathing Solutions
    Try no-rinse washes or wipes designed for sensitive skin to simplify bathing.

  5. Offer Help When Needed
    Assist with brushing teeth or washing hair if she’s comfortable with it.

  6. Improve the Home’s Scent
    Lightly scented candles or air fresheners can reduce unpleasant odors and promote calm.

  7. Get Family and Caregiver Support
    A team approach ensures she gets consistent care and attention.

  8. Explore Community Resources
    Senior centers or home health services offer social engagement and extra help.

Moving Forward with Love and Patience

Supporting your grandmother’s hygiene takes patience, kindness, and understanding. By acting proactively and using available resources, you help her stay healthy and happy. Most importantly, treat her with love and respect to preserve her dignity and independence.
